Flow hits the plate, is disrupted, and then rolls around the sides of the plated and then is smoothed and directed out of the manhole by the cheek walls. In an Energy Absorbing Manhole, the energy absorber is a flat plate set perpendicular to the flow stream. In-flume energy absorbers are somewhat different than those used in Energy Absorbing Manholes. When more than one tranquilizing rack is used, the Parshall flume inlet end adapter usually has to be lengthened to accommodate the installation of the racks. Tranquilizing racks are fabricated from 304 or 316 stainless steel and are secured to the flume or upstream channel through the use of bolts or screws through the top mounting plate. Like the perforated baffle plates above, tranquilizer racks are typically used in groups of two or more, with the first rack disrupting the flow and the second rack straightening it out before it enters the converging section of the Parshall flume. Tranquilizer racks are vertical racks that are slid down into the channel or end adapter upstream of the flume. As a result, Openchannelflow offers tranquilizing racks to condition flow in larger Parshall flumes. For these sizes, the perforated plates used above tend to flex under the force of the incoming flow and reinstallation under flow conditions can be difficult. Larger Parshall flumes – 6-inches and above – require more robust flow conditioning. Baffle plates are not normally retrofitted into existing applications as the recesses for the baffle plates are molded into the sidewalls / floor of the inlet end adapter – although surface mounted baffle plates are possible. Constructed of 1/4-inch PVC sheet, the plates rest in side / bottom cavities and can be easily removed should they ever become clogged or if the flume needs more flow capacity. The baffle plates are perforated in a staggered pattern and, used in groups of two or more, help to break up poor inlet velocity profiles. Smaller Parshall flumes – typically 1-3-inches in size – can have perforated baffle plates installed in the inlet end adapter.
